Historical Context of Permanent Hair Removal
The journey of permanent hair removal has evolved significantly over time, reflecting changing societal attitudes toward body hair and beauty standards.
Early methods of permanent hair removal began with rudimentary electrolysis techniques in the late 19th century, eventually progressing to the sophisticated laser treatments we see today.
Cultural perspectives on body hair have shifted dramatically, with different societies maintaining varying views on what constitutes ideal body hair patterns.
Modern Evolution
The development of permanent hair removal technologies has revolutionized how we approach personal grooming.
Laser hair removal and advanced electrolysis methods have made permanent hair reduction more accessible and effective than ever before, leading to increased adoption and acceptance of these procedures.
Defining Permanent Hair Removal
Understanding the Procedures
Modern permanent hair removal primarily consists of two main approaches: laser hair removal and electrolysis.
Laser treatments target hair follicles using specific wavelengths of light, while electrolysis employs electrical currents to destroy individual follicles.
These methods differ significantly from temporary solutions like waxing or shaving, offering longer-lasting results that can profoundly impact an individual’s daily routine and self-perception.

Exploring the Psychological Impact
The psychological effects of permanent hair removal often manifest in various ways, significantly influencing an individual’s self-perception and emotional well-being.
Many people report experiencing enhanced self-confidence and improved body image after successful treatments.
Body Image and Self-Perception
The relationship between permanent hair removal and body image is complex and multifaceted.
For many individuals, the reduction or elimination of unwanted hair can lead to a more positive self-image and increased comfort in social situations.
Emotional Journey
The process of undergoing permanent hair removal can trigger a range of emotions, from excitement and anticipation to anxiety about results.
Many individuals report feeling a sense of empowerment and control over their appearance, while others may experience temporary uncertainty during the treatment process.
